SALAFIN (Groupe BMCE)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ow Calculation

SALAFIN (Groupe BMCE)'s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ow=- Capital Expenditure / Cash Flow from Operations
=- (-5.537) / 44.42
=0.12

SALAFIN (Groupe BMCE)  (CAS:SLF)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ow Explanation

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ow ratio assesses how much of a company’s Cash Flow from Operations is being devoted to Capital Expenditure. It is a good indicator in terms of how much the company is focused on growth. In general, a high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ow ratio indicates that the company is investing more in physical assets and is focused on growth and expansion. Conversely, lower ratio could indicate that a company has reached maturity and is no longer pursuing aggressive growth.

Moreover, the ratio is also useful to distinguish whether the company is capital intensive or not. If the ratio is large, then the company tends to be capital intensive. Lower ratio suggests that it’s a capital-light business. The ratio can be combined with ROIC % to identify whether the company is an asset-light business that has a high return on invested capital. SALAFIN (Groupe BMCE) is a Morocco-based company. It is a finance company. It offers consumer credit services. The company operates through various business segments that are Personal Credit, which include personal loan, and mortgage credit; Auto Financing, which provides car loans; and Revolving Credit.
